Why it stands out
The 2017 Toyota 4Runner remains a popular choice in the midsize SUV segment, thanks to its rugged reliability and impressive off-road capabilities. Owners appreciate its solid construction, which contributes to its long-lasting value and dependable performance on diverse terrains. The 4Runner maintains a gritty off-road character while providing modern amenities such as advanced safety technology and connectivity features. Key highlights include a spacious interior and excellent resale value, making it an attractive option for those seeking a versatile SUV. While it may not excel in city driving or fuel economy, the 4Runner offers a unique blend of strength, reliability, and capability that appeals to adventurous buyers.

2017 Toyota 4Runner Trims
| Trim type | MSRP |
|---|---|
| TRD Off-Road 4WD | $37,335 |
| TRD Pro 4WD | $42,400 |
| Limited | $42,525 |
| SR5 | $34,210 |
| TRD Off-Road Premium 4WD | $39,295 |
| SR5 Premium 4WD | $37,915 |
| SR5 4WD | $36,085 |
| Limited 4WD | $44,560 |

Trim-Level Details
| Trim | Listings | MSRP | Drivetrain | Engine |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| SR5 4WD | 82 | $36,085 | 4X4 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| Limited 4WD | 75 | $44,560 | AWD |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| TRD Off-Road Premium 4WD | 58 | $39,295 | 4X4 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| SR5 Premium 4WD | 65 | $37,915 | 4X4 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| TRD Off-Road 4WD | 37 | $37,335 | 4X4 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| TRD Pro 4WD | 38 | $42,400 | 4X4 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| SR5 | 37 | $34,210 | 4X2 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
| Limited | 20 | $42,525 | 4X2 | 4.0L 270 hp V6 |
